How much does it cost to rent a home in Philadelphia?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Philadelphia 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,118 | $640 | $7,350 |
Philadelphia 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,185 | $640 | $10,000+ |
Philadelphia 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,785 | $690 | $10,000+ |
Philadelphia 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,877 | $650 | $10,000+ |
Philadelphia 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,369 | $525 | $10,000+ |
Philadelphia 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,716 | $4,200 | $5,200 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Philadelphia
What type of rentals are currently available in Philadelphia?
There are currently 8352 Apartments for Rent in Philadelphia, PA with pricing that ranges from $250 to $29,970. There are also 3057 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Philadelphia ranging from $525 to $24,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Philadelphia?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Philadelphia ranges from $525 to $24,000 with an average monthly rent of $3,647.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Philadelphia?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Philadelphia range from $599 to $18,280,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$640 to $17,900.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$690 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$655.
